“Whenever I got extremely angry, he would end up in hospital”

The first wife of late Nollywood actor Taiwo Hassan Ogogo, Ajoke Taiwo, has spoken about her late husband following his death.
Ajoke, who said she was married to the veteran actor for more than 30 years, described him as a caring husband who played an important role in her life.
She disclosed this in an emotional interview while reflecting on their marriage and the loss of the actor.
‘He Was My Everything’
Ajoke revealed that she met Taiwo Hassan through the movie industry and was also an actress before she stopped acting to focus on raising their children.
She described the late actor as a loving husband and said he stood by her during difficult periods.
“I am Ajoke Taiwo, the first wife of Ogogo. He was a very good man, a caring husband and he truly loved me. He was like a father and mother to me. He stood by me during the times of trial. He was my everything.”
Speaking about his death, she said the loss had left a deep wound that she believed would never completely heal.
“What God took from me is so big and it really hurts me but I can’t question Him. This is a wound that can never heal.”
‘He Never Wanted Me to Get Angry at Him’
Ajoke also recalled how her late husband reacted whenever she became extremely angry with him.
According to her, Taiwo Hassan would become so emotionally affected that he would eventually require hospital care.
“He never wanted me to get angry at him. Whenever I get extremely angry, he used to land at the hospital because he would be so hurt.”
The comments came shortly after the actor’s death and burial, which attracted tributes from family members, colleagues and other sympathisers.
Taiwo Hassan’s daughter had earlier announced his death after revealing that the actor had been battling stage-four cancer.
The veteran actor was subsequently buried in Ilaro, Ogun State, with several Nollywood stars and other mourners in attendance.
